The Greater Yellowstone ecosystem: redefining America's wilderness heritage

Keiter RB and Boyce MS. 1991. The Greater Yellowstone ecosystem: redefining America's wilderness heritage. Yale University Press. New Haven, CT

Specialists in science, economics and law discuss key resource management issues in the Greater Yellowstone ecosystem, using them as starting points to debate the manner in which humans should interact with the environment of this area. Papers from a symposium on the Greater Yellowstone Ecosystem, hosted by the University of Wyoming in Apr. 1989.
